What are Discord Communities?
Discord communities are groups of people with shared interests who come together on the Discord platform to chat, share content, and collaborate. For music producers, these communities offer a space to share tracks, get feedback, and connect with other producers, industry professionals, and potential collaborators.

Top Discord Communities for Music Producers
1. The Pro Audio Files
With over 20,000 members, The Pro Audio Files is one of the largest and most active Discord communities for music producers. This community is a great place for producers of all levels to share their work, get feedback, and learn from others. The community is well-moderated, with experienced producers and industry professionals offering guidance and support.
2. Music Production Forum
The Music Production Forum Discord community is another popular platform for producers to connect, share, and learn. With a focus on music production, sound design, and audio engineering, this community offers a wealth of knowledge and expertise. Members can share their tracks, get feedback, and participate in discussions on various aspects of music production.
3. WeAreTheMusicMakers (WATMM)
WATMM is a large and active community of music producers, with over 30,000 members. This community is a great place for producers to share their work, get feedback, and connect with other producers. WATMM also hosts regular events, such as track critiques and production challenges, which can help you improve your skills and stay motivated.
4. The Mixing and Mastering Community
If you're looking for a community focused on mixing and mastering, this Discord server is a great place to join. With experienced engineers and producers offering guidance and support, you can learn new skills and improve your craft. Members can share their mixes and masters, get feedback, and participate in discussions on various aspects of mixing and mastering.
5. The Electronic Music Production Community
This community is specifically designed for electronic music producers, with a focus on genres like EDM, techno, and house. With a large and active membership, this community offers a great place to share your tracks, get feedback, and connect with other producers who share your interests.
How to Get the Most Out of Discord Communities
To get the most out of Discord communities for music producers, it's essential to be active and engaged. Here are some tips:
- Introduce yourself and share your work
- Participate in discussions and offer feedback to others
- Join community events and challenges
- Be respectful and professional in your interactions
- Follow community rules and guidelines
Challenges and Limitations of Discord Communities
While Discord communities can be a great resource for music producers, there are also challenges and limitations to consider. For example:
- With so many communities to choose from, it can be hard to find the right one for you
- Some communities may have strict rules or moderators, which can be limiting
- It can be overwhelming to keep up with multiple communities and conversations
